1997
 
    
Diana, the Princess of Wales, and her friend Dodi Fayed die after a car crash in Paris       
1998
 
   
The European Court of Human Rights replaces a preceding part-time court in Strasbourg      
1999
 
   
A fire in the Mont Blanc road tunnel kills 39 people and closes the tunnel for three years      
2000
 
    
A Concorde supersonic airliner crashes after take-off from Paris, killing all 109 on board       
2001
 
   
UK terrorist Richard Reid tries to bring down a Paris-Miami flight but fails to light the exposive in his shoe      
2004
 
   
Palestinian president Yasser Arafat dies in a hospital near Paris      
2005
 
   
The superjumbo Airbus A380 makes its first test flight from Toulouse      
2005
 
   
The French people become the first to reject, in a referendum, the proposed European Constitution      
2005
 
    
US cyclist Lance Armstrong retires from competition after winning a seventh successive victory in the Tour de France       
2005
 
   
French surgeon Bernard Devauchelle and his team in Amiens carry out the first human face transplant
